The cups come from my great aunt Agnes Roche, aka Tante, who used them to offer tea to the young women in Schafer Hall at Wellesley, where she was housemother, circa 1936. The silver sugar bowl and spoons and the brass tray are all from Iran--again many years back.
The cloth is also from Iran, a kalamkar--a wood block print on fabric.

The Abby Beecher Roberts house (1937) in Deertrack. Wright did not approve of many of the changes the owners made to his design.
Abby Beecher Roberts was the mother-in-law of Frank Lloyd Wright's student, John Lautner, and supervising this building was one of the first jobs Lautner did for Wright. You can read more about it in a great interview with Lautner, available at www.archive.org/details/responsibilityin00laut
